Why ISO 22301 Internal Auditor Training Matters in Bahrain

Bahrain's business environment includes organizations that depend on stable service delivery, secure information, resilient supply chains, and well-coordinated response to disruptive events. Management needs employees who can review continuity arrangements objectively and determine whether the BCMS is functioning as planned.

An internal auditor does more than check documents. A capable BCMS auditor reviews context, business continuity objectives, risk thinking, business impact analysis outputs, continuity strategies, response procedures, testing, competence, and corrective action effectiveness. This ISO 22301 Auditor Training in Bahrain helps organizations move beyond paper-based continuity planning. It builds internal capability so audits become practical management tools for resilience, governance, and stronger readiness before customer, regulatory, or certification audits.

What the Training Covers

The training explains the standard in clear language and then translates it into real internal audit activity. Participants learn how to review BCMS documents, speak with process owners, verify implementation, and judge whether continuity arrangements are usable, coordinated, and supported by evidence.

Understanding ISO 22301 and the BCMS Approach

Participants learn the structure of ISO 22301 — context, leadership, planning, support, operation, performance evaluation, and improvement — with attention to business impact analysis, continuity strategies, incident response, and recovery planning.

Planning an Internal Continuity Audit

This part covers audit objectives, scope, criteria, annual audit programme planning, audit trails, and checklist preparation focused on functions, sites, and activities that matter most to resilience.

Conducting the Audit and Testing Implementation

Participants learn interviewing techniques, evidence review, observation methods, and how to verify awareness, roles, plan control, exercise records, communication arrangements, and follow-up of identified gaps.

Writing Findings and Driving Follow-Up

The course explains how to classify issues, write nonconformities clearly, communicate audit results professionally, and support corrective action and closure verification.
